I built ChessBooker to stop scheduling chess lessons over DMs and back-and-forth

Hey Indie Hackers 👋

I’m Miguel, a solo founder and chess player.

I built ChessBooker after looking for my first chess coach and realizing how painful scheduling lessons was. Everything happened over DMs or email — long back-and-forth threads, time zone confusion, and waiting just to confirm a time.

ChessBooker is a simple booking page built specifically for chess coaches:

  • Coaches set availability and lesson length once

  • Students book instantly via a link (no DMs, no waiting)

  • Calendar events and meeting links are created automatically

  • Past lessons stay organized in one place
